I personally would say it’s less not good enough and more a work in progress.
For me it feels a little too empty and synthetic. The land is unnaturally flat by the buildings and the river is too straight. The trees and bushes are a good touch, however they are all the same and feel a bit randomly placed. Having the nature more clustered together could help a bit, especially if you resize some of the trees to make them feel different. It would be a good idea to have a bit more variety with the trees, whether that be new species, or just having the leaves be different shades of green.
All that said the horizon looks great in this picture, and I really like the bridge and that white building in the distance. Overall, nothing looks particularly bad, it just needs a bit more added to it.
All that said, if players are only spending 10 seconds between matches here, there is the argument that it doesn’t need to be particularly good anyways. Natural disaster survival has literally just a platform with game pass billboards on it, and it was doing well enough to be in the hunt event. (despite being well over a decade old).
